Step1: Recall rotation rules

The rule for a \(270^{\circ}\) counter - clockwise rotation about the origin is \((x,y)\to(y, - x)\). The rule for a \(90^{\circ}\) clockwise rotation about the origin is also \((x,y)\to(y, - x)\). Since the rotation described (either \(270^{\circ}\) counter - clockwise or \(90^{\circ}\) clockwise) gives the same transformation.
